    Description

    Our hotel is located on the historic Nakasendo trail, in the beautifully preserved post town of Narai-juku, surrounded by mountains, forests, and rivers in the Kiso Valley.
    We welcome travelers from all over the world, many of whom are walking the Nakasendo route.

    Staying and working with us is a great chance to explore the Nakasendo and experience authentic Japan : traditional post towns, scenic routes in the mountains and countryside, and historic cities like Matsumoto and Kiso-Fukushima.

    We provide accommodation, meals, and hourly pay. You’ll usually work up to 5 hours a day, with days off to relax or travel around.

    We’re a small, friendly team and we’re happy to welcome people who are curious about Japan and enjoy meeting travelers.

    Cultural exchange and learning opportunities

    You’ll experience Japanese culture directly by working with a local host, a Japanese chef, and our team, learning how things are done in everyday life and in a hospitality setting.

    At the same time, our guests come from all over the world, so you’ll also be part of an international environment, meeting travelers and sharing experiences with people from different countries.

    It’s a mix of local Japanese culture and a social, international atmosphere.

  • Accommodation

    Accommodation

    You’ll stay in a traditional Japanese-style room, similar to a ryokan, with tatami flooring and a futon bed, offering a n authentic Japanese living experience. We provide three meals a day, plus hourly pay of ¥1,060.

  • What else ...

    What else ...

    On your days off, you can explore the area and travel around easily. With a train station nearby, it’s easy to reach different places by train or bus, and you can also enjoy cycling around the area.
